177355 Surgery Scheduler, Boston, MA, 2 months Contract Sigma, Inc. is looking for a Surgery Scheduler to join the transplant institute at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center in Boston, MA.
Shift Options : Monday - Friday, 40 hrs per week
7:30 AM – 4:00 PM
8:00 AM – 4:30 PM
8:30 AM – 5:00 PM
Job Summary:
The Surgery Scheduler will be responsible for coordinating and scheduling transplant-related surgeries for a team of 7 surgeons. This position will work closely with patients, physicians, surgeons, clinical staff, and other members of the healthcare team to ensure surgical scheduling requests and appointments are handled accurately and in a timely manner.
The ideal candidate will have previous healthcare scheduling, surgical scheduling, or OR scheduling experience, preferably within a hospital or outpatient healthcare setting.
Key Responsibilities:
Coordinate and schedule transplant-related surgeries for multiple surgeons.
Manage surgery scheduling requests and ensure appointments are scheduled accurately and efficiently.
Communicate with patients regarding scheduling, appointments, and related information.
Coordinate with surgeons, physicians, nurses, clinical teams, and other healthcare professionals.
Maintain accurate scheduling information and documentation.
Review scheduling requests and prioritize tasks based on urgency and clinical needs.
Resolve scheduling conflicts and coordinate changes as needed.
Follow established scheduling procedures, policies, and departmental workflows.
Provide timely communication and follow-up to patients and clinical teams.
Support a fast-paced, multidisciplinary healthcare environment.
